As this handy-dandy screenshot I found shows:

http://www.tfclub.com/tffans/rom/200310110001_10279.jpg

...there's been a fair bit of reorganising going on there. The original
airing order, according to Zob's site, was:

66. "Five Faces of Darkness" part 1
67. "Five Faces of Darkness" part 2
68. "Five Faces of Darkness" part 3
69. "Five Faces of Darkness" part 4
70. "Five Faces of Darkness" part 5
71. "The Killing Jar"
72. "Chaos"
73. "Dark Awakening"
74. "Forever is a Long Time Coming"
75. "Starscream's Ghost"
76. "Thief in the Night"
77. "Surprise Party"
78. "Madman's Paradise"
79. "Nightmare Planet"
80. "Ghost in the Machine"
81. "Webworld"

They dropped Nightmare Planet and Ghost in the Machine, and moved up Carnage
in C-Minor and Fight or Flee.
